Understanding Mesotherapy
Mesotherapy is a non-surgical cosmetic procedure that involves injecting a customised mixture of vitamins, minerals, and amino acids into the mesodermal layer of the skin. This technique targets issues such as pigmentation, poor circulation, and skin laxity, which can contribute to dark circles. The treatment aims to rejuvenate and nourish the skin, promoting a more youthful and refreshed appearance. It is essential to understand that mesotherapy is not a one-size-fits-all solution and should be tailored to each individual’s specific concerns.
